Climate-concerned clergy cycle to Downing Street

August 16th, 2008

Clergy from the Diocese of Oxford recently cycled to Downing Street to deliver a petition with 10,000 signatures in support of more government action on climate change. The petition, compiled by relief and development agency Tearfund, urges Prime Minister Gordon Brown to do everything he can to secure a strong Climate Change Bill.

A Rocha work in Portugal

June 27th, 2008

An area of the Algarve protected by environmental laws has been destroyed by developers according to environmental groups who are now leading court action and calls for the land to be restored to its former state. A Rocha Portugal is working to help this situation.

A Rocha helps to preserve biodiversity in Jabal Moussa

June 27th, 2008

The Association for the Protection of Jabal Moussa is seeking official protection for 10 million square meters of land at a time when Lebanon is still recovering from devastating forest fires and environmental damage that plagued the country last year.
